This first floor two bedroomed apartment gives wonderful views across the valley to Whitby and comprises of an open plan living room and fully equipped kitchen with dining area. There is one double bedroom and one twin bedroom, two bathrooms, one en-suite with a Victorian style roll-top bath and one with a separate powerful shower.
The apartment is fully equipped including bedding, towels, iron and ironing board. A travel cot and high chair can also be provided if required.
Sneaton lies on the south side of the Lower Esk Valley, within the North York Moors National Park, well known for its attractive scenery and walks. This rural village has Beacon Farm, famous for its ice cream parlour and The Wilson Arms. The heritage coastline is nearby with villages such as Robin Hoods Bay and Sandsend having popular beaches. The historic old fishing port of Whitby, lying 3 miles to the north, boasts an excellent selection of restaurants, shops, a marina and a golf course.

By Road:
From Whitby head south out of town through Ruswarp on the B1416. Sneaton lies around 3 miles from Whitby town centre and you will find Sneaton Hall on your left hand side as you enter the village.
By Public Transport:
Taxi from Whitby town centre or railway stations in both Ruswarp and Sleights Village.
Arriva bus No. 95 takes you from Whitby as far as Ruswarp, which is approximately 1 mile from Sneaton.
